The advent of Artificial Intelligence (AI) has profoundly impacted the industrial cloud market, offering new capabilities for predictive analytics, process optimization, and automation. AI technologies integrated into cloud platforms enable industries to leverage vast amounts of data generated by IoT devices. These AI-driven insights help companies make informed decisions, reduce downtime, and improve overall productivity. For example, AI algorithms can predict equipment failures before they occur, allowing for proactive maintenance and reducing costly downtime. As AI continues to evolve, its potential to enhance cloud platforms in industrial settings becomes increasingly apparent, driving further demand for cloud-based solutions.
Moreover, the combination of AI and cloud computing creates a powerful synergy that fosters innovation in various industries such as manufacturing, energy, and logistics. AI allows industrial cloud platforms to continuously learn from data, enabling them to become more efficient and accurate over time. This ability to process and analyze large datasets in real-time allows businesses to streamline operations, reduce operational costs, and improve overall efficiency. The integration of AI into the industrial cloud market is expected to lead to the development of more advanced applications, creating new opportunities for businesses to stay competitive in an increasingly digital world.

One of the major restraints affecting the industrial cloud market is data security and privacy concerns. As more businesses adopt cloud-based solutions, they become more vulnerable to cyberattacks and data breaches, particularly if sensitive information is stored in the cloud. This is especially problematic in industries like healthcare, energy, and manufacturing, where data privacy is a significant concern. To mitigate these risks, companies must invest in robust security measures, such as encryption, multi-factor authentication, and compliance with industry standards. Despite these solutions, the potential for security breaches remains a key challenge for the market, which could slow down adoption and hinder market growth.
Another restraint is the integration challenges associated with moving from traditional on-premise systems to cloud-based platforms. Many industries still rely on legacy infrastructure, and the transition to the cloud can be complex, requiring significant time, effort, and resources. Moreover, some businesses may face resistance to change from employees who are accustomed to older systems or who lack the necessary skills to operate new technologies. This can delay the adoption of industrial cloud solutions and result in higher costs for businesses. As companies continue to grapple with these challenges, overcoming the barriers to cloud adoption will be critical for realizing the full potential of the industrial cloud market.

Recent developments in the industrial cloud market have been largely driven by advancements in technology and increased adoption of cloud-based solutions by industrial organizations. One notable development is the growing focus on multi-cloud and hybrid cloud strategies, as businesses seek to avoid vendor lock-in and maintain flexibility in their cloud deployments. By utilizing multiple cloud providers, companies can diversify their infrastructure and better manage risk. This approach also allows businesses to take advantage of specialized services offered by different cloud providers, resulting in a more tailored and efficient solution. As multi-cloud strategies gain traction, they are expected to play a key role in the market’s growth and development.
Another significant development is the increasing adoption of AI and machine learning technologies in industrial cloud platforms. These technologies are being used to automate processes, enhance predictive maintenance, and improve decision-making. As AI algorithms become more sophisticated, they are expected to drive greater efficiency and innovation in industrial operations. Additionally, the rise of edge computing is enabling faster data processing and real-time decision-making, further enhancing the capabilities of industrial cloud platforms. These developments demonstrate the ongoing evolution of the industrial cloud market and its potential to transform industries across the globe.
